Detartrage and boiler maintenance

I have a gas boiler for heating and hot water that fills up a hot water cylinder.


I got a letter from the regie telling me I had to do a 'detartrage'. Does anyone know how much these typically cost?


Also for annual boiler maintenance, how much do you pay?

You must check your first Etat de Lieu when you moved in the house.


Check also the lease and additional clauses in particular as well as tenancy rules in Geneva(or Vaud) canton which copy was handed on to you.


Most of the times it is mandatory to sign a maintenance contract for the boiler and the heater, but below are important points to consider:


1.Have you moved in a house with a brand new boiler just installed before you arrived? 2.Was the boiler decalked shortly before you moved in with all your furniture ?


3.Have you been notified with a receipt in that sense for point 1. or 2. ?


Besides, not knowing the size of the furnace, the type and the volume to be heated inside your "mansion" one cannot guess on the cost. Feel free to tell us more.

Ondrej:


The water boiler needs to be decalked on average every  3 years max when such unit is used frequently which is certainly the case in an apartment where there are individual charges with heating & hot water.


Now is the time for you to call the maintenance company. Estimating the size of the unit it might turn to treatment roughly ca. CHF 250.- done by a professional .


Better call several experts in the field to compare prices and estimates (unless you are renting a flat under strict LGZD building rules).
